The business base in Kensington & Chelsea
Officially the Royal Borough of Kensington and Chelsea · inner London
Sloane Street, Brompton Road and the King's Road anchor the luxury retail offer, while the Pimlico Road and Chelsea Harbour form the centre of the UK interiors and antiques trade.
South Kensington's museums and institutions draw significant visitor traffic, and the borough supports a dense layer of private clinics, dental practices, galleries and estate agencies.
What that means for marketing in Kensington & Chelsea
Clients in this market equate presentation with competence, and a website that looks inexpensive undermines a premium fee before a conversation starts. Photography quality and restraint matter more here than volume of content.

Does a premium brand still need SEO?
Yes, though the targets differ. Prestige businesses often neglect search because referrals have always been enough, then find that a new generation of buyers researches online first. The valuable terms are usually specific — a named service, a named area — rather than broad category searches.
